Key Differences
- Riva 128 has more Memory size (4 MB on standard RIVA 128 boards vs 1 MB).
- Riva 128 has more Memory bandwidth (1.6 GB/s vs 0.4 GB/s).
- Boost clock: STG-2000 has 75 MHz; Riva 128 has 100 MHz.
- TDP / TBP / board power: STG-2000 has 2 W; Riva 128 has About 4 W class.
- Architecture: STG-2000 has NV1; Riva 128 has NV3 / RIVA fixed function 2D, video, and 3D accelerator.
- Launch date: STG-2000 has 1995-09-30; Riva 128 has 1997-08-25.
